Bhubaneshwar: Former IAS officer Sujata Rout Karthikeyan joined the Biju Janata Dal (BJD) on Thursday. The 2000-batch IAS officer said she is blessed to get an opportunity to work under the leadership of party chief and former Odisha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ik.

Sujata Rout Karthikeyan inducted into BJD by Naveen Patnaik in Odisha | Image: X

She was formally inducted into the party by Patnaik.

'I'm Very Fortunate': Karthikeyan

Sujata Karthikeyan taking Naveen Patnaik's blessings during induction ceremony | Image: X

After joining BJD, Karthikeyan said she is very fortunate to have the opportunity to work under Naveen Patnaik leadership and serve the people of Odisha for the last 24 years.

"Today again, I am blessed to get this opportunity once again to work for the state under the leadership of Naveen Patnaik sir. With the grace of Lord Jagannath and blessings of people of Odisha, I shall continue to work for Odisha and her people with complete dedication and commitment," she added.

Patnaik Welcomes Karthikeyan

Naveen Patnaik warmly welcomed Sujata Rout Karthikeyan into BJD. Sharing pictures from the induction ceremony on X, Patnaik wrote, "She will serve the party as an ordinary worker."

He also recalled that as an administrative officer, Karthikeyan has done many good works. “Holding various positions, she has fulfilled the hopes of countless people. Especially through ‘Mission Shakti’ for mothers and in enriching the ‘Odia language’, she has made a significant contribution,” he added.

He further expressed belief that she will serve the Biju Janata Dal and the people of Odisha with dedication.

Who Is Sujata Rout Karthikeyan?

Sujata Rout Karthikeyan | Image: X

Sujata Rout Karthikeyan is a 2000-batch Indian Administrative Service (IAS) officer. She is the wife of former Odisha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ik's close aide and bureaucrat-turned-politician VK Pandian.

She did her Bachelors in Political Science from Lady Shri Ram College, University of Delhi, where she was a university topper. She obtained her Master's degree in International Politics from Jawaharlal Nehru University (JNU).

She was awarded the Asok Bomabwale Award for the Best Officer Trainee in Lal Bahadur Shastri Academy.

She was closely associated with Odisha's ‘Mission Shakti’ initiative under the Patnaik government. Under her leadership, the scheme grew to a robust movement of 70 lakh women. The scheme led to the rise of women’s enterprises across Odisha.

Mission Shakti is the self-help mission for empowering women through promotion of Women Self Help Groups (WSHGs) to take up various socio-economic activities. It was launched in the state on 8th March, 2001, on the eve of International Women’s Day. The programme has the clear objective of empowering women through gainful activities by providing credit and market linkage. 

Sujata Rout Karthikeyan also served as the collector of Naxal-affected Sundergarh. During her tenure, she introduced egg in the Mid-Day Meal scheme in all government schools of the district. She also introduced a bicycle distribution programme for schoolgirls through bank sponsorship to reduce dropout rates among tribal students in the district.

Known as “football collector" in Sundergarh, Karthikeyan promoted sports in rural areas and also distributed footballs in villages. She encouraged children to take up sports and stay away from Naxal activities or drugs .

Further, she was the first woman collector of Cuttack district.
